Output d89e37d75ed9c76187841ccf8bd2243061f0a05c1aabcfe86f29e46571ae7a17:1

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4ec334aa471bed2f8047b6b48dc4d09773b028f OP_EQUAL
address
3M6r8haHyuQjz8RQCAf5qJBxF3owPyNjVW
transaction
d89e37d75ed9c76187841ccf8bd2243061f0a05c1aabcfe86f29e46571ae7a17
spent
true